Hello, first off, I am a complete newbie. I know very little about computer terminology.

Anyway, I purchased a software program called Nero 7: Ultra Edition in order to transfer home movies to my computer. I've figured out how to trim them down into smaller clips. But my next goal was to upload them onto Youtube.

The clips are saved on my desktop as .NRG files. I tried to upload one to Youtube. And I had no problem with it. However, since that initial success, Youtube hasn't let me upload any additional clips. I can upload them. But I then get an error message that says something like "FILE NOT RECOGNIZED."

Youtube says that that it accepts files in the .AVI, .MOV, and .MPG file formats. So how it accepted (and plays) my initial upload is a mystery to me.

At this point, I'm looking for a way to convert my .NRG files into either .AVI, MOV, or .MPG formats.

Can anyone explain how to do this? Do I need to purchase some additional software? Any help would be greatly appreciated!

Ok what you have is a Nero image file (.nrg). You don't want that for uploading to youtube.

What format were the files from your homevideo camera thing?

Ok so if you have a DVD with the files on, you want to Rip the files form the dvd, to VOBs (a dvd compliant format).

Use DvdShrink (free) to rip them off. Get that here...
http://www.softpedia.com/get/CD-DVD-Tool...VD-Shrink.shtml

Use this guide on how to Rip the files.
http://www.doom9.org/index.html?/mpg/dvdshrink31-main.htm

Then when you have your files (ripped to your harddrive) you can use this
http://www.afterdawn.com/software/video_...ers/dvd2avi.cfm
to convert to AVI and upload to Youtube.
